The National Ski Areas Association, the trade association for ski area owners and operators, recently held its national meeting at La Costa Resort and Spa. Representing 329 alpine resorts that account for more than 90 percent of the skier/snowboarder visits nationwide, the organization partnered with HD Relay to bring live views of the event for members unable to attend the convention.
HD Relay's eLiveStream system allowed cross browser access to live views of the marketing awards ceremony in full high definition with stereo quality audio.
